Answer:

1) Option A - 0.05 cm

2) Option A - 2%    

Step-by-step explanation:

1. Given : Measurement 4.7 cm.    

To find : The greatest possible error for the measurement 4.7 cm.

Solution :

The greatest possible error in a measurement is half of the measuring unit.

Measurement 4.7 cm.    

4.7 was measured to the nearest tenth of a cm or 0.1 cm

So the measuring unit is 0.1.

The GPE is half of 0.1

i.e, \frac{0.1}{2}=0.05

Therefore, Option A is correct.

The greatest possible error for the measurement 4.7 cm is 0.05 cm.
